Georgia Architectural and Historic Properties Survey of Rural [254] Valdosta, Ga. December 1980. Named: Dixie Plantation. A one story long rectangular plan with gabled tin roof and clapboard siding. Shed porch with square posts. Sash windows with 6/6 lights. Interior chimneys and exterior chimneys. Good condition. Carriage house, stables, cattle. Date of Construction: c. 1902. According to Mr. Jim Loudermilk, the plantation was developed by a Mr. Livingston who had holdings in North Florida and South Georgia. After his death, he left the plantation to his daughters. The main house is located in Jefferson County, FLA, about one or two miles south of the Georgia line.
